Examples

300 miles in 5 hours, then convert the result to km/h

A driver completes a long highway trip of 300 miles in exactly 5 hours of total travel time, including fuel stops averaged into the duration. They want their average speed in miles per hour and the equivalent in kilometres per hour to compare against road signs in a country that uses metric units.

ResultAverage speed = 60 mph = 96.5606 km/h ≈ 26.82 m/s

Apply v = d / t with consistent units: 300 mi divided by 5 h gives 60 mph. To convert to metric, multiply by the exact factor 1 mph = 1.609344 km/h, so 60 × 1.609344 = 96.5606 km/h. For m/s, divide km/h by 3.6: 96.5606 / 3.6 ≈ 26.82 m/s. The conversion 100 km/h ≈ 62.137 mph follows the same factor in the other direction.

What is the difference between speed and velocity?

Speed is a scalar quantity that measures how fast an object moves, regardless of direction. Velocity is a vector quantity that includes both speed and direction. A car driving 60 mph north and a car driving 60 mph south have the same speed but different velocities. In everyday driving and most calculator use, the two terms are used interchangeably, but in physics problems involving forces, acceleration, or relative motion, the distinction matters.

What is the difference between average and instantaneous speed?

Average speed is total distance divided by total time over a trip, so a 300 mi trip in 5 h gives 60 mph even if you actually drove 75 mph for stretches and stopped for fuel. Instantaneous speed is the speed at one moment in time, like the value your speedometer shows right now. This calculator returns average speed because it uses the full distance and full duration; it does not capture variation along the way.

How do I convert between mph, km/h, and m/s?

The exact conversion factor defined by NIST and the BIPM is 1 mile per hour = 1.609344 kilometres per hour. To convert km/h to mph, divide by 1.609344 (or multiply by 0.621371). To convert km/h to m/s, divide by 3.6, because 1 km = 1000 m and 1 h = 3600 s. So 100 km/h ÷ 3.6 ≈ 27.78 m/s, and 100 km/h ÷ 1.609344 ≈ 62.14 mph. The factor 1 m/s ≈ 2.237 mph follows from combining the two.

How accurate is the speed reading from a phone or GPS?

Consumer GPS receivers typically report speed accurate to within roughly 0.1 m/s (about 0.2 mph) under open sky once they have a steady fix, because they derive speed from the Doppler shift of the satellite signals rather than from differencing positions. Accuracy degrades in urban canyons, tunnels, dense forest, or when the receiver has just acquired a fix. For most driving, cycling, and running uses the GPS reading is more accurate than a typical analogue speedometer.

Why does my car speedometer read slightly higher than my actual speed?

Regulators in most countries require that speedometers never indicate less than the true speed, so manufacturers deliberately calibrate them to overread by a small margin. UNECE Regulation 39, which is followed across the EU, UK, Japan, Australia and many other markets, allows the indicated speed to be up to 10% plus 4 km/h higher than the true speed but never lower. In the US, NHTSA and SAE J1226 follow a similar principle. Larger tyres, low pressure, or aftermarket wheels can shift the reading further, which is why a GPS speed is usually a few percent below the dashboard value.
